AI Giants Spark a New Cybersecurity Arms Race: What Businesses Must Do to Stay Protected

The Rise of AI-Powered Cybersecurity Competition

As artificial intelligence industry leaders rush to develop and implement digital defenses against new cyber risks, the cyber threat scenario has changed dramatically. According to a recent report from Business Insider, major AI companies such as OpenAI and Anthropic have been investing heavily in cybersecurity to mitigate the increasing threat of cybercrime spurred by the use of advanced AI technology. The use of AI technology by organizations is now creating new avenues for cyberattackers to use advanced tools and techniques to attack their targets in an increasingly intelligent, automated, and scalable manner. Consequently, this change in the cyber threat landscape has raised the level of concern regarding enterprise security, data protection, and cyber risk management internationally in all sectors.

Today’s enterprises do not face just traditional malware or phishing attempts as cybersecurity threats. Cybersecurity threats now include social engineering assisted by AI, automated discovery of vulnerabilities, impersonation attacks using deepfakes, and large-scale exploitation of data. While innovation has increased with the introduction of generative AI, it also has created a significant new attack surface for which organizations need to take urgent measures to secure. Therefore, decision-makers will need to consider cybersecurity as more than an ancillary IT function, it will become a key business priority.

Why AI Is Reshaping Cybersecurity Threats

There are significant changes occurring in cyberattacks facilitated by AI technologies. They are capable of accelerating reconnaissance processes, producing fake phishing emails, imitating executive speaking tone, and identifying vulnerabilities of software applications faster than ever before. AI-based techniques developed for improving efficiency and increasing productivity become useful for attackers who can accelerate their operations with the help of innovative solutions.

The issues mentioned above regarding cybersecurity concerns mentioned by Business Insider prove that even those companies that have been actively developing AI face the problem of necessity to increase security levels. As new AI-based innovations are penetrating various industries, including healthcare, financial institutions, manufacturing, logistics, and governments, there will be more pressure on businesses to enhance cybersecurity services and vulnerability management.

However, it is not cybersecurity issues only that businesses should care about nowadays. Indeed, regulatory challenges linked to data protection, AI governance, and other aspects related to its use are also becoming increasingly serious. This means that enterprises are currently forced to focus on both cybersecurity challenges and corporate governance ones.

Enterprise Security Challenges Businesses Cannot Ignore

The primary concern for organizations at the present time is the growing gap between technological innovation and the state of preparedness for cybersecurity. Organizations have adopted artificial intelligence (AI) applications much faster than an appropriate risk assessment of the associated cyber risk can be completed. This creates vulnerabilities to be attacked before appropriate measures to protect against them are in place by the organizations.

For example, organizations using AI-enabled platforms may expose their internal systems to attackers through insecure APIs, weak authentication controls, and insufficient monitoring. In addition, employees using AI tools for which they do not have authorization may inadvertently expose confidential company data to the outside world, resulting in significant data protection risks. The use of shadow AI inside organizations is emerging as one of the most overlooked cybersecurity risks in today’s corporate environment.

Another significant issue is that cybercriminal groups are increasingly using AI to identify and identify high-value targets, tailor and customize their extortion schemes, and use AI to circumvent detection systems during the execution of an attack. Cyber-attacks have become increasingly intelligent and adaptive, and, as such, traditional security measures will not provide adequate protection; organizations will require proactive vulnerability management, continuous security monitoring, and the ability to detect and respond quickly to emerging threats. Unique to some digital-dependent industries is that downtime due to cyber incidents has a very high risk of having severe consequences on the financial viability of an organization, as well as creating long-term liabilities for company reputation and regulatory approval.

The Growing Importance of Proactive Cybersecurity Strategies

It becomes increasingly necessary for modern business organizations to go past reactive measures to secure their systems from cyberattacks. The proactive strategy should be one that incorporates regular risk assessment procedures to discover system flaws which may potentially be exploited in the future. This explains why vulnerability assessments, penetration tests, and real-time security monitoring have become important features of modern security systems.

At the same time, companies should invest in cybersecurity awareness programs among employees as AI is used to launch sophisticated phishing attacks which are almost impossible to recognize. Indeed, human error still ranks among the most common causes of cyberattacks, hence the need for cybersecurity training for employees. Companies should also incorporate zero trust security models, multi-factor authentication, endpoint security, and other cybersecurity protocols in their operations.
